    I didn't try to block any email contact yet but I find something in hub settings for you.
    Maybe it will work very easily.
    Go to 'Hub'.
    Tap on three vertical 'Dots'
    Find 'settings' and open it.
    Then find 'Recent contact management' and tap on it. That is one you are looking for.
    Here you will see all your email contact, easily tap on any contact for block them.

    #3 is right. The best and most consequent way for blocking unwanted email starts always on the incoming mail server. Check the spam filtering capabilities on the website of your mail server. Using device capabilities is not good - you change the device and have again all these crap immediately.
